World's first 787-10 Dreamliner delivered to Singapore Airlines

World's first 787-10 Dreamliner delivered to Singapore Airlines
The first Boeing 787-10 Dreamliner has been delivered to Singapore Airlines. The latest and largest of the Dreamliner family was handed over to its new owner in a ceremony at Boeing's North Charleston, South Carolina assembly facility attended by 3,000 people and will enter scheduled service in May after flying selected routes to Bangkok and Kuala Lumpur for crew training. It will then operate on routes between Singapore, Osaka, and Perth.

Air New Zealand takes off to Taipei

The Air New Zealand Boeing 787-9 Dreamliner Aircraft
Feb 22, 2018  -  Air New Zealand has today announced it will start operating non-stop flights between Auckland and Taipei from November 2018.  The airline will fly up to five times a week between Auckland and Taipei’s Taoyuan International Airport from November, with NZ77 departing Auckland at 10:35am and arriving in Taipei at 4:50pm local time. NZ78 will depart Taipei at 6:30pm local time, arriving in Auckland at 10:20am+1.

Air New Zealand reports $323m interim result, on track for second highest profit in company history

Feb 22, 2018  -  Air New Zealand today announced earnings before taxation for the first six months of the 2018 financial year of $323 million, compared to $349 million in the prior period. Net profit after taxation was $232 million.
